Fix `switch` parsing

There are actually two fixes: the first one is a direct fix to the
linked issue. The attribute of the rule for switch was wrong. I'm not
sure how I missed that, but OK, now we have tests.

The other bug:
For some reason, the completion generator prevented the symbol table
parser from running and the value inside the resulting switch_ was
undefined. Asserting the attribute of the completion generator seems to
solve the issue.

I thought this would have something to do with the fact that I'm using
single member fusion structs. However, the bug still persisted even when
converting them into non-fusion structs (as suggested in the first
issue).

At some point, all single-member fusion structs should be converted into
non-fusion structs, but because it doesn't solve my problem, I won't be
doing it now.

Console interface to NETCONF servers

This program provides an interactive console for working with YANG data. It can connect to NETCONF servers, and also talk to sysrepo locally.

Installation

For building, one needs:

  • A C++17 compiler
  • Boost version 1.69
  • cmake for managing the build
  • libyang for working with YANG models
  • libnetconf2 for connecting to NETCONF servers
  • sysrepo version 1.4.x for the local sysrepo backend, and for the comprehensive test suite
  • replxx which provides interactive line prompts
  • docopt for CLI option parsing
  • pkg-config for building
  • Doctest as a C++ unit test framework
  • trompeloeil for mock objects in C++

Use an exact commit of any dependencies as specified in submodules/dependencies/*.

The build process uses CMake. A quick-and-dirty build with no fancy options can be as simple as mkdir build && cd build && cmake .. && make && make install.
